JiHae L.

There are several good things about this brewery, such as they stay open late. This place serves drinks after the 8th inning, which is when most of the spots at the stadium stop. Also, they have the original blue moon beer recipe on tap before it was sold to coors this anywhere else. There are several different beers on tap that aren't served elsewhere at the coors field. They do serve food but stop after a certain time. There is a place to drink indoors, and they have you exit where the sidewalk is as they close up the stadium. The people working here are all very friendly. The place itself is clean.
